I would like to have a little welcoming gift for each of the kids when the arrive in the room. Nothing big. A plush, a light up toy, and a t shirt or something similar. Mind you, this is x5! I have used Memories By Betsy (before it was Betsy) in the past. The problem was that it wasn't in the room upon arrival. (or maybe they don't know what room we'll be in until arrival?) I was looking at the WDW florist site, but there doesn't seem to be anything that fits the bill. Most of the stuff seems geared toward some specific celebration (birthday etc) or it is a large and very expensive basket, which is not an option x5.

My questions are: Will they take custom orders or do they only do the things on the site? Do they deliver things like toys and t shirts or other Disney merchandise? Will the things be in the room upon arrival or will they be delivered to the room later or be handed to me at check in like my "Betsy" baskets?
 
They deliver to your room on a specified day but not necessarily at your arrival. I have ordered from them several times and have had things in the room on arrival and arrive as late at 8:30. I think it just depends on the volume. They don't promise a specific time.
